How To Increase Your Capacity:

1. By challenging your current situation and circumstances. What kind of limitations are you battling with? What are your inadequacies? What is the lid on your business or career? Whatever they are, it is time to confront and face them squarely. Don’t accept the status quo! Stand up against your limitations! Until you challenge your Goliaths, you won’t grow or conquer them. So what are you waiting for? As you confront these enemies of your souls, I see you gaining the upper hand in Jesus name amen. 1Chro4v9-10.

2. Start Doing New Things. This is how to increase your capacity. Start doing new things! Stop doing only those things you have done before and start doing things you could and should do. Stop delaying the things you could and should do! Start doing them now! Growth is always outside your comfort zone! Step out of your comfort zone and enter into the challenge zone! You will never grow or go beyond the things you have mastered. So when are you going to start confronting your fears, insecurities and Goliaths?
